The Benefits Of Track Linear: Improving Efficiency In Movement

track linear is a method used to guide linear motion along a specific path. This technology is commonly utilized in various industries, from automotive production lines to conveyor systems in warehouses. track linear systems consist of rails, guides, and bearings that facilitate smooth and precise movement along a fixed path.

One of the key benefits of track linear is its ability to improve efficiency in movement. By providing a predefined path for linear motion, track linear systems can help streamline processes and reduce errors. In manufacturing settings, track linear can be used to automate tasks such as assembly and packaging, ensuring that products move seamlessly along the production line.

track linear is also known for its precision and accuracy. The rails and guides of track linear systems are designed to minimize friction and ensure smooth motion, allowing for precise positioning of components or products. This level of accuracy is essential in industries where even small errors can have a significant impact on the quality of the final product.
